A MAC address management system acquires code data obtained by encoding a temporary MAC address that can be temporarily used and decodes the acquired code data to perform wireless communication. The MAC address management system includes a MAC distributing server device in which a temporary MAC address which can be temporarily used is stored and a wireless communication device that acquires the temporary MAC address from the MAC distributing server device and performs wireless communication by using the acquired temporary MAC address, the wireless communication device acquires code data obtained by encoding the temporary MAC address from the MAC distributing server device, decodes the acquired code data, and performs wireless communication by using the decoded temporary MAC address.

1. A wireless communication device that obtains a temporary Media Access Control (MAC) address, that is used for performing wireless communication through an access point, from a distributing server device provided in a network storing the temporary MAC address corresponding to a unique MAC address and transmitting code data of the temporary MAC address encoded by a secret encryption key corresponding to the unique MAC address to the wireless communication device, comprising: a code data acquiring section that acquires the code data of the temporary MAC address from the distributing server device by transmitting the unique MAC address given to the wireless communication device, and stores the code data of the temporary MAC address in a Random Access Memory (RAM) of the wireless communication device; anda wireless communication section that decodes the code data of the temporary MAC address by using a public encryption key pre-stored in a Read Only Memory (ROM) of the wireless communication device only when performing the wireless communication using the temporary MAC address,wherein the temporary MAC address, the unique MAC address, the public encryption key and the secret encryption key are managed in relation to each other in the distributing server device. 2. The wireless communication device according to claim 1, wherein the code data acquiring section acquires from the distributing server device the code data of the temporary MAC address and expiration date information representing a period during which the code data of the temporary MAC address is valid, and stores the expiration date information together with the code data of the temporary MAC address in the RAM; and the wireless communication section decodes the code data of the temporary MAC address during the valid period indicated by the expiration date information for performing the wireless communication using the temporary MAC address, and requests the code data acquiring section to acquire new code data of the temporary MAC address from the distributing server device when the valid period of the code data of the temporary MAC address indicated by the expiration date information has expired. 3. The wireless communication device according to claim 2, wherein the temporary MAC address managed in the distributing server device corresponds to a serial number unique to the wireless communication device and encoded by a secret encryption key corresponding to the serial number when transmitted to the wireless communication device, and the code data acquiring section acquires from the distributing server device the code data of the temporary MAC address by transmitting the serial number,wherein the temporary MAC address, the serial number, the public encryption key and the secret encryption key are managed in relation to each other in the distributing server device. 4. The wireless communication device according to claim 2, wherein the code data acquiring section acquires from the distributing server device time information in addition to the expiration data information for updating time synchronization between the wireless communication device and the distributing server device. 5.
